Abstract

To prevent subsequent plasticizer migration an article, e.g flooring or extruded tubing, composed at least in part of a polyvinyl composition is treated by applying an adhesive for the polyvinyl composition and nylon comprising a solution of an organic di-isocyanate to the polyvinyl composition surface, applying a solution of a soluble nylon on top of the adhesive and allowing the solvent to evaporate. Soluble nylon is that soluble in lower aliphatic alcohols and the preferred nylon is one in which some of the amino hydrogens have been replaced by hydroxy methyl groups e.g. prepared by treating polyhexamethylene adipamide with formaldehyde, and may be in solution in a mixture of water and ethanol or n-propanol. The polyvinyl composition may be plasticized polyvinyl chloride sheet or polyvinyl chloride coated fabric. An additional layer of a different substance, e.g. rubber composition which may be vulcanized before or after application, asphalt, bitumen, oils and/or organic substances soluble in oils, may be adhered to the nylon layer, which layer is first coated with an adhesive for the different substance and for nylon. In examples:- (1) a polyvinyl chloride leathercloth is coated with a toluene solution of diphenyl methane diisocyanate and then soluble nylon in a propanol-water mixture is applied; (2) a polyvinyl chloride sheet is coated as in (1), then a diisocyanate-rubber mixture adhesive solution is applied to the nylon coating, and a vulcanized rubber backing, coated with rubber solution, adhered thereto; (3) as in (2) but the rubber is unvulcanized, is without a rubber solution coating, and is vulcanized subsequently.
